Blockchain = Transparency + Trust
One of the biggest game-changers is the use of blockchain technology. With every transaction visible on-chain, players can verify that the games they’re playing are fair. This is known as "provably fair gaming," and it gives users the power to validate the randomness of outcomes themselves—no more taking the casino’s word for it. This level of transparency builds a new kind of trust between player and platform, something that has always been challenging in online gaming.
